2 Li Shujuan, male, Ph.D., Professor, supervisor of doctoral and master’s students. Director of the Key Laboratory of Embedded Technology Application in Liaoning Province; member of the Popular Science Working Committee of the Chinese Association for Artificial Intelligence; member of the Environmental Perception and Protection Automation Committee of the Chinese Association of Automation. He obtained his M.S. degree in Electrical Engineering from the School of Electrical Engineering, Shenyang University of Technology in 1993, and his Ph.D. degree in Industrial Automation from the Automation Research Center, Northeastern University in 1998; from 2001 to 2003 he worked as a Research Fellow in the School of Electrical and Electronic Engineering, Nanyang Technological University, Singapore.
Research interests: intelligent control theory and its applications; embedded systems and applications; wireless sensor networks; modeling and control of complex processes; optimization control of central air-conditioning systems; wind-power control technology; environmental measurement and control for protected agriculture; intelligent control of large-scale agricultural plant-protection machinery.
Scientific achievements: in recent years, as project leader, he has been undertaking and has completed ten projects, including sub-projects of the National Key R&D Program of China, projects of the National Natural Science Foundation of China, projects of the Liaoning Provincial Department of Education, and projects of the Shenyang Science and Technology Program; he has also presided over twelve major cooperative projects with enterprises, and has published more than ninety papers in important domestic and international journals and conferences.

3 Wang Yanhong, Female, Ph.D., Professor, Doctoral Supervisor. Awarded the Ph.D. in Control Theory and Control Engineering from Jilin University, and is a candidate for Liaoning Provincial "Hundred-Thousand-Talent Program" (Thousand-Level Talent).
Research direction: AI-Based Production Scheduling & Optimization; Mobile Robot Path Planning & Motion Control; Smart Factory & Digital Twin Systems; Intelligent Control & Decision Optimization.
Research achievements: Hosted multiple research projects and enterprise horizontal projects, including Liaoning Provincial Key R&D Program, Liaoning Provincial Natural Science Foundation, Liaoning Provincial Department of Education Key Research Project, Liaoning Provincial Department of Education Research Fund Project, Shenyang Science and Technology Fund Project, etc. Published over 30 SCI or EI indexed papers in important domestic and international journals such as the International Journal of Computer Integrated Manufacturing, and Control Theory and Applications (Chinese core journal), Control and Decision (Chinese core journal), Robotics (Chinese core journal), etc., and was selected as one of the top 5% highly cited scholars by CNKI in 2024; Authorized 2 Chinese Invention Patents and 2 software copyrights. As the first completer, won the third prize of Liaoning Provincial Science & Technology Progress Award and the third prize of Shenyang Municipal Science & Technology Progress Award.

9 Zhang Yuxian, Ph.D., Professor, Doctoral Supervisor. He received the Ph.D. degrees in control theory and control engineering at Northeastern University, China. He worked in postdoctoral of control science and engineering at Tsinghua University, China. Now, he is an Executive Dean of School of Artificial Intelligence in Shenyang University of Technology. He is an outstanding teacher of Liaoning Province, council member of Liaoning Automation Society, member of Special Committee of Active Distribution Network and Distributed Generation Committee of CES, and member of the Education Committee of Automation Teaching of Chinese Machinery Industry Association.
His current research interests include condition monitoring and fault diagnosis of electromechanical equipment, coordinated optimization of multi-energy systems, and integrated energy systems.
He has undergoing or participated in more than 20 research projects funded by national, provincial, and enterprises. He has published nearly 100 papers as first author or corresponding author in domestic and international journals. He holds 5 authorized invention patents and 2 utility model patents. He received the Second Prize of the China Machinery Industry Science and Technology Award. As the first contributor, he has won three First Prizes for Provincial Teaching Achievements and has led or participated in five provincial teaching reform projects. He is responsible for a first-class course and has published two books. He has conducted academic training at Ritsumeikan University in Japan and has undertaken short-term academic visits to internationally universities such as Kochi University of Technology in Japan, Nottingham University in the United Kingdom, and Politecnico di Torino in Italy.
